How to Make Knitting Needles
Interesting in picking up knitting with your child? Well skip the trip to the store to pick-up your brand new knitting needles -- if you have a pair of chopsticks lying around from a past take-out dinner, then you have DIY craft waiting to happen! Help your child craft her first pair of knitting needles with just a little sharpening, sanding and painting.
What You Need:
- Wooden chopsticks
- 2 clothespins
- Pencil sharpener
- Coarse sandpaper
- Wax paper
- Newspaper
- Acrylic paint
- Paint brush
What You Do:
- Help your child sharpen the tips in a standard pencil sharpener. Be careful: the tips will likely be rough and splintery.
- Have her sand down the tips of each chopstick with the coarse sandpaper.
- When all the splintery edges have been removed, let her finish sanding the rest of the chopsticks as well.
- Have her place newspaper on a flat surface.
- Next, help your child place the thicker end of each chopstick into the pinching part of each clothespin.
- Have her paint her chopsticks. Encourage her to be creative -- and to also keep the paint over the newspaper.
- Allow the chopsticks to dry completely.
- Then, help your child rub the sheet of wax paper over each chopstick. Now she's ready to become a knitting master!
